3500 calories= one pound of fat...
a typical fat loss nutrition plan will range between 1200 to 1500 calories...an average untrained overweight individual has an resting metabolic rate somewhere between 1200 to 1500 calories...
a typical one hour resistance training program burn 500 to 600 calories...followed with 30 minutes of cardio in the fat burn zone and another 300 calories...plus daily activities another 300 calories...this create a 700 to 1000 caloric deficit...
which means...you are burning up more calories than you are taking in...forcing the body to learn how to burn fat effectively and efficiently...and so you slowly begin to burn more fat...one pound of fat=3500 calories...
